Born on March 28, 1946, in Kansas City, Missouri, Dianne Wiest grew up in a family that appreciated the arts. Her father was a musician, and her mother was a housewife with a passion for theater. Wiest's early exposure to performance arts led her to pursue acting, ultimately studying at the University of Maryland and the prestigious Actors Studio in New York City.

Throughout her career, Wiest has received numerous accolades, including two Academy Awards for Best Supporting Actress, showcasing her expertise and authority in her craft. Early Career

Wiest's early career was marked by her theater performances, where she showcased her exceptional talent. She gained recognition for her roles in various off-Broadway productions. Her breakthrough in film came when she starred in "Ruthless People" (1986), which opened doors for more significant roles in Hollywood.

Notable Roles in Film

Academy Award Winning Performances

Wiest's performances in "Hannah and Her Sisters" (1986) and "Bullets Over Broadway" (1994) earned her Academy Awards for Best Supporting Actress. These films highlighted her ability to portray complex characters with depth and nuance.

Theater Works

In addition to her film career, Dianne Wiest has made significant contributions to theater. She has performed in numerous acclaimed productions, including "The Glass Menagerie" and "The Cherry Orchard." Her theater work showcases her versatility and dedication to the craft of acting.
